Schiopetto Pinot Bianco 2016

Vinous: 90pts 

Bright straw yellow with golden highlights. Open-knit and ripe, with a full-blown nose of yellow plum, candied pear and peach nectar. Broad, rich, spicy and tactile, with flavors similar to the aromas. The finish is long and saline. This is almost Pinot Grigio-like in its size and also speaks of the warm Capriva microclimate (it clocks in at 14.5% alcohol compared to the Volpe Pasini Pinot Bianco wine – both the Volpe Pasini and the Schiopetto estates are owned by the Rotolo family – which is made from grapes grown in the cooler Torreano subzone of the Friuli Colli Orientali: that wine sports only 13% alcohol).
